@Sudalius

Как получить навыки в Objective C?

Уважаемые друзья,
благодаря одному курсу с грехом пополам я разобрался с основами. Массивы, циклы, селекторы, нотификации, протоколы. Почти понял что такое делегаты. С MVC тоже разобрался. Параллельно читаю книги по Objective-C известных авторов. В голове потихоньку все укладывается.
Однако, меня беспокоит следующий этап. Что дальше? Если я правильно понимаю, то нужно зазубривать различные методы и где они применяются? Просто, вот попросят меня сейчас создать что-то простенькое с TableView. Смастерить я его смастерю в storyBoard, а вот вставить нужные методы, чтобы он корректно заработал (numberOfRowsAtIndexPath и прочие) я не смогу, потому что я не знаю. Получается, что мне надо под чьим-то руководством сделать это раз 50 и тогда в три часа ночи я смогу с закрытыми глазами его сделать?

Верно ли я понимаю, что познавать нужно на примерах и подобным разбором? Что только так можно научиться писать что-то самостоятельно.

Буду благодарен за советы
  • Вопрос задан
  • 375 просмотров
Пригласить эксперта
Ответы на вопрос 3
tikhonov666
@tikhonov666
iOS, Swift, Objective-C
Параллельно читаю книги по Objective-C известных авторов. В голове потихоньку все укладывается.

чтобы он корректно заработал (numberOfRowsAtIndexPath и прочие) я не смогу


Работа с tableView и отображение данных это основа основ. Во всех книжках описывается, как это работает во всех подробностях - читайте, пробуйте, экспериментируйте. На текущем уровне вас никто не возьмет под свое руководство, так что дерзайте.

Вот материалы в помощь.
Ответ написан
f0r3s1
@f0r3s1
iOS Developer
Если ты претендуешь на джуна, то посмотри тут что тебе нужно знать, чтобы разрабатывать минимальные приложения. Если ты что то не знаешь, то гуглишь по-английски. Например если тебе нужны эти делегаты от TableView то это выглядит так: uitableviewdelegate methods. Тут первые две ссылки: первая - это официальная документация по tableView, вторая - примеры использования на stackowerflow. Берешь оттуда пример, читаешь оф документацию и редактируешь как тебе нужно.
Ответ написан
Комментировать
Если хотите ускориться, найдите толкового преподавателя и возьмите несколько уроков. Второй вариант это пойти работать интерном, где по сути также будет много самообразования, но уже под присмотром опытных разработчиков и тогда через пару месяцев возможно будет вариант перевестись в джуны.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ы